After being shot during the violent takeover of the U.S. Embassy in Tehran in 1979, Ken Kraus regains consciousness in a hospital—only to be abducted again and taken to the infamous Evin Prison, a place notorious for its torture and psychological warfare.

In this intense continuation of the Game of Crimes interview, host Steve Murphy dives deeper into the unbelievable true story of Ken Kraus who reveals the brutal methods of interrogation, the physical and emotional torture, and the haunting moments that tested the very limits of human endurance. Facing sadistic captors, unimaginable pain, and psychological torment, Ken never broke—refusing to betray his fellow Marines or his country. His story is one of unshakable resilience, brotherhood, and the will to survive.
